Faith Osifo

Year of Call: 2023

Faith specialises in criminal defence law, with a strong interest in youth justice and wider criminal matters.

Faith started her pupillage at Garden Court Chambers in October 2025.

Her first-six supervisor is supervisor Sam Parham, and her second six supervisor is Audrey Cherryl Mogan.

Before pupillage, Faith was a paralegal at a criminal defence firm in London where she assisted the managing partner and a senior associate. She helped to represent clients accused of a wide range of offences including drug trafficking, sexual offences, money laundering and illegal arms trafficking. She gained experience working with young and vulnerable clients, conducting conferences and prison visits, and drafting written representations.

Prior to this, she was a County Court advocate who regularly appeared before judges in courts across London in a range of matters. Faith also contributed to research into the role of communities and connections in social welfare legal advice as part of her work as a Community Researcher for the Advice Services Alliance.

Faith has extensive volunteering experience. She has attended London police stations as an independent custody visitor to check on the welfare of detainees and has taught debate at HMP Brixton. She has also volunteered on the Amicus Missouri Project and has worked as a youth advocate with BLAM.
